Output 9604525f02414d20342448ce06701bf225d15824872fe46d1cb49348612de77b:25

value
303759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e74e19acba1bfdfd10de7b0bd0b4ee9c9d765e6 OP_EQUAL
address
3QtTaKc1htJJBfx1CoTcL4xcqyrFL6H4J6
transaction
9604525f02414d20342448ce06701bf225d15824872fe46d1cb49348612de77b
spent
true